Output 953f543b5da4a29b521341373f8a8e212617e96e5083c3760327973fe5b266cd:0

value
209414
script pubkey
OP_0 OP_PUSHBYTES_20 d2966027eaf3bb711c03f2724437a24731e04244
address
bc1q62txqfl27wahz8qr7feygdazguc7qsjy7k0r5f
transaction
953f543b5da4a29b521341373f8a8e212617e96e5083c3760327973fe5b266cd
confirmations
108450
spent
true